子程序在數(shù)控銑床銑削加工中的應(yīng)用之加工平面
在數(shù)控銑床銑削加工中使用立銑刀銑削平面,通常需要銑刀來回多次走,一個(gè)來回為一個(gè)循環(huán),可用子程序來編程。下面以30立銑刀銑削100 x 100平面為例(見圖1),參考程序如下: 參考程序O0001;(主程序) //主程序名G54 G90 G40; //建工件坐標(biāo)系,程序初始化G0Z100; //快速定位至安全高度M3S600; //啟動(dòng)主軸X一70Y一50M8;//XY向快速定位至循環(huán)起點(diǎn)Z2; //Z向快進(jìn)至工件上方2 mmG1Z一1F200; //下刀M98P11L3; //3次調(diào)用子程序O0011G90G0Z100; //抬刀至安全高度X0Y200 //工作臺(tái)靠近操作工M30; //主程序結(jié)束O0011;(子程序) //子程序名G91 X140 ; //向右銑Y20; //向前移刀X一140; //向左銑Y20; //向前移刀至下一循環(huán)起點(diǎn)M99; //子程序結(jié)束并返回主程序說明: (1)銑平面下刀動(dòng)作放在主程序,子程序?yàn)樗阶叩秳?dòng)作; (2)每行銑削刀具起點(diǎn)、終點(diǎn)宜靠近工件邊緣(X一70); (3)避免滿刀全覆蓋切削,首末次走刀刀具邊沿縱向伸出工件大于(1/3 --1/4)刀直徑(Y -50); (4)走刀行距控制在0.50一0.90倍刀具直徑,保證平面質(zhì)量( Y20)